Dinstar FXO Gateway UAE Information
The Dinstar FXO Gateway UAE product family is designed for businesses that need a dependable bridge between older analog telephone lines and modern IP communication networks. In many UAE offices, PSTN lines are still used for main numbers, backup call paths, lift phones, fax communication, reception lines or existing PBX trunks. A Dinstar FXO gateway allows these lines to be connected into a SIP environment so that calls can be managed through an IP PBX, softswitch or hosted telephony platform.
The official Dinstar FXO range includes models such as DAG1000-2O, DAG1000-4O, DAG1000-8O and DAG2000-16O. These models cover small office requirements, growing branch offices and higher-density deployments. The 16-port DAG2000-16O is especially useful for organizations that need multiple telecom operator lines connected to a business phone system. It supports SIP-based operation, fax handling, routing rules and network management features that help IT teams control voice traffic more professionally.

Dinstar FXO Gateway UAE Features
When customers compare FXO gateways across the market, they usually look for stable SIP registration, clear audio, predictable routing, easy administration and compatibility with common PBX platforms. The Dinstar FXO Gateway range addresses these needs with models that can connect analog lines to IP-based voice systems while supporting practical enterprise features. For businesses that run IP PBX systems, hosted PBX platforms or mixed analog and VoIP environments, this gateway family can reduce migration pressure and improve call control.
Important features include SIP v2.0 support, IPv4 and IPv6 capability on selected models, QoS options, VLAN tagging, T.38 fax, pass-through fax, call forwarding, call waiting, transfer, speed dial, hunting groups, system logs, CDR, backup and restore, and remote management options such as SNMP and TR-069. The 16 FXO model is positioned for higher-density connectivity, while smaller models suit compact offices and branch locations.

Dinstar FXO Gateway Understanding With Other Models
Dinstar’s wider communication portfolio includes analog gateways, GSM and LTE gateways, IP PBX systems, digital VoIP gateways, IP phones, session border controllers and SIP intercom products. For customers reviewing the FXO gateway, it is useful to understand nearby product families. An FXS gateway is normally used to connect analog phones or fax machines to an IP PBX. An FXO gateway is normally used to connect external telephone lines or analog PBX trunks to an IP PBX. A hybrid FXS/FXO gateway can support both use cases in one device when the project requires mixed connectivity.
The Dinstar DAG1000-2O is suited to compact requirements where only a small number of analog lines need to be bridged. DAG1000-4O and DAG1000-8O fit growing offices and branch locations. DAG2000-16O supports larger deployments where multiple PSTN lines must connect into a centralized voice platform. Hybrid models such as DAG2000-8S8O may be considered when both analog phone extensions and line-side connectivity are required.

Dinstar FXO Gateway UAE Deployment
A successful Dinstar FXO Gateway deployment begins with accurate planning. The first step is to count the analog lines and decide which lines must remain active. The next step is to review the PBX or SIP platform that will receive calls from the gateway. Network readiness is also important because voice quality depends on stable LAN connectivity, proper addressing, firewall access, QoS design and suitable cabling.
Fourteck can help prepare a deployment checklist covering FXO port mapping, SIP account settings, inbound routes, outbound routes, call permissions, emergency call behavior, business hour rules, fax requirements, failover scenarios and backup configuration. For rack-based installations, power availability, ventilation and patch panel labeling should also be reviewed.
During deployment, testing should include inbound calls, outbound calls, caller ID behavior, DTMF response, call transfer, fax test if required, failover test, and voice quality checks. Clear documentation helps the customer manage future changes without confusion.
Dinstar FXO Gateway UAE Installation Details
Installation requires coordination between the telephone line side, the network side and the PBX side. The analog PSTN lines are connected to the FXO ports of the gateway. The gateway is then connected to the LAN and configured with the correct IP settings. After network access is ready, the SIP connection to the PBX or voice platform can be configured. Each port may then be mapped to routing rules so calls move through the correct path.
